Stefan Kraemer is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Cancer Research and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Stefan Kraemer has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 154 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 8 papers in Cancer Research and 4 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Stefan Kraemer's work include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(8 papers), Advanced Breast Cancer Therapies (5 papers) and Breast Lesions and Carcinomas (4 papers). Stefan Kraemer is often cited by papers focused on Breast Cancer Treatment Studies (8 papers), Advanced Breast Cancer Therapies (5 papers) and Breast Lesions and Carcinomas (4 papers). Stefan Kraemer coll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Switzerland and United States. Stefan Kraemer's co-authors include Bjoern G. Volkmer, Hans‐Werner Gottfried, Rainer Kimmig, Mahdi Rezai, Steffen Basche, Peter Kern, Rainer Kuefer, Georg Nickenig, Gerhard Bauriedel and Dirk Skowasch and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er Research and The Journal of Urology.
